241. To ask the Minister for Education and Skills the amount expended by her Department in each of the past five years to date in 2021 on electricity costs in tabular form; and if she will provide an additional schedule that sets out all energy costs associated with their ICT hardware, that is, servers and so on in tabular form. [60934/21]
Norma Foley (Kerry, Fianna Fail)
Link to this: Individually | In context | Oireachtas source
My Department occupies three main campuses in Marlborough Street, Tullamore and Athlone. In addition, the Department also maintains the ESBS offices in Blanchardstown and 41 local offices throughout the country.
The table below displays the total the Department of Education has expended on electricity in each of the years 2017, 2018, 2019, 2020 and to date in 2021.
Please note that it is not possible to separate the amount the Department expends on energy costs associated with ICT hardware alone. Therefore, the figures below include all electrical costs.
2017 | 2018 | 2019 | 2020 | YEAR TO DATE 2021 |
---|---|---|---|---|
€335,011.72 | €401,133.05 | €357,124.97 | €375,852.16 | €314,155.85 |
